[发明专利]一种第三方接口调用方法及装置在审
申请号: | 202111044980.1 | 申请日: | 2021-09-07 |
公开(公告)号: | CN113791883A | 公开(公告)日: | 2021-12-14 |
发明(设计)人: | 陆继春;陈贺巍 | 申请(专利权)人: | 百融至信(北京)征信有限公司 |
主分类号: | G06F9/48 | 分类号: | G06F9/48;G06F9/50 |
代理公司: | 北京鼎佳达知识产权代理事务所(普通合伙) 11348 | 代理人: | 刘铁生;孟阿妮 |
地址: | 100000 北京市朝阳*** | 国省代码: | 北京;11 |
权利要求书: | 查看更多 | 说明书: | 查看更多 |
摘要: | |||
搜索关键词: | 一种 第三 接口 调用 方法 装置 | ||
1.一种第三方接口调用方法,其特征在于,所述方法包括:
确定适用于目标任务的各第三方接口的优先级顺序以及各所述第三方接口的目标服务次数,其中,所述目标服务次数表征对应的第三方接口单位时间内能够提供稳定服务的理想次数;
在单位时间内,每接收一次所述目标任务的调用请求均执行:确定当前无异常的第三方接口为目标第三方接口,从所述单位时间内累计调用次数未达到对应的目标服务次数的目标第三方接口中,选取优先级最高的目标第三方接口为针对所述调用请求的目标第三方接口,调用所选取的目标第三方接口。
2.根据权利要求1所述的方法,其特征在于,在从所述单位时间内累计调用次数未达到对应的目标服务次数的目标第三方接口中,选取优先级最高的目标第三方接口为针对所述调用请求的目标第三方接口之前,所述方法还包括:
确定各所述第三方接口的累计调用次数是否均达到对应的目标服务次数;
若否,从所述单位时间内累计调用次数未达到对应的目标服务次数的目标第三方接口中,选取优先级最高的目标第三方接口为针对所述调用请求的目标第三方接口。
3.根据权利要求2所述的方法,其特征在于,所述方法还包括:
若确定各所述第三方接口的累计调用次数均达到对应的目标服务次数,则确定上一次调用请求的目标第三方接口是否是优先级最低的第三方接口;
若是优先级最低的第三方接口,确定各所述目标第三方接口中优先级最高的目标第三方接口为针对所述调用请求的目标第三方接口;
若不是优先级最低的第三方接口,确定优先级位于上一次调用请求的目标第三方接口下一位的目标第三方接口为针对所述调用请求的目标第三方接口。
4.根据权利要求1-3中任一所述的方法,其特征在于,确定当前无异常的第三方接口为目标第三方接口,包括:
将未记录在故障文本中的第三方接口,确定为所述目标第三方接口,其中,所述故障文本中记录有在第一预设时长内出现异常的次数达到预设次数阈值的第三方接口。
5.根据权利要求4所述的方法,其特征在于,所述方法还包括:
监测记录在故障文本中的各第三方接口在其各自对应的第二预设时长内是否排除异常;
将排除异常的第三方接口从所述故障文本中删除。
6.根据权利要求1-3中任一所述的方法,其特征在于,确定适用于目标任务的各第三方接口的优先级顺序,包括:
根据各所述第三方接口的服务参数,确定各所述第三方接口的优先级顺序,其中,所述服务参数包括如下中的至少一种:响应耗时、目标服务次数、服务价格。
7.根据权利要求1-3中任一所述的方法,其特征在于,所述方法还包括:
若确定当前不存在无异常的第三方接口,告警。
8.一种第三方接口调用装置,其特征在于,所述装置包括:
确定单元,用于确定适用于目标任务的各第三方接口的优先级顺序以及各所述第三方接口的目标服务次数,其中,所述目标服务次数表征对应的第三方接口单位时间内能够提供稳定服务的理想次数;
调用单元,用于在单位时间内,每接收一次所述目标任务的调用请求均执行:确定当前无异常的第三方接口为目标第三方接口,从所述单位时间内累计调用次数未达到对应的目标服务次数的目标第三方接口中,选取优先级最高的目标第三方接口为针对所述调用请求的目标第三方接口,调用所选取的目标第三方接口。
9.一种计算机可读存储介质,其特征在于,所述存储介质包括存储的程序,其中,在所述程序运行时控制所述存储介质所在设备执行权利要求1至权利要求7中任意一项所述的第三方接口调用方法。
10.一种存储管理设备,其特征在于,所述存储管理设备包括:
存储器,用于存储程序;
处理器,耦合至所述存储器,用于运行所述程序以执行权利要求1至权利要求7中任意一项所述的第三方接口调用方法。
该专利技术资料仅供研究查看技术是否侵权等信息,商用须获得专利权人授权。该专利全部权利属于百融至信(北京)征信有限公司,未经百融至信(北京)征信有限公司许可,擅自商用是侵权行为。如果您想购买此专利、获得商业授权和技术合作,请联系【客服】
本文链接:http://www.vipzhuanli.com/pat/books/202111044980.1/1.html,转载请声明来源钻瓜专利网。
- 上一篇:一种基于自适应初温设置的模拟退火粒子群算法
- 下一篇:一种静电喷雾装置